I've had arthritis since I was a teen. Start off with low-impact things. Walking. Swimming. Yoga is great for arthritis. These things will loosen you up and make you feel like you can do more. Getting more active has made great improvements in my arthritis management. For a lot of people (me included), arthritis stiffens…

are you weighing your food on a digital scale? You're probably eating more than you think. I'm 5'2", older than you, and was able to lose while eating no less than 1450 calories, and more on days that I exercised.
